The National Association of Mutual Insurance Companies said it has organized its team of lobbyists to push an "aggressive" agenda in state legislatures next year.

Indianapolis-based NAMIC said five regional state affairs managers (SAMs) are in place and will address legislation to beintroduced in the 44 state legislatures holding sessions in 2006.

"NAMIC member companies have established an aggressive advocacy agenda for 2006 and our staff is well placed to provide representation before state legislatures and insurance regulators," said Senior Director of State Advocacy Neil Alldredge.
